Action item: The Relayn deploy-status bot silently dropped updates when the pipeline API paginated results, so responders believed a rollback had completed when it had not. We will add pagination handling, a staleness banner, and an integration test. Until merged, verify deploy state directly in the pipeline console, documented at the page below.

runbook for kahop-kajop: https://rundeck.ordinio.test/display/secrets/pipeline/issue/pages/repo/browse/e5732776e07d1285107e5aeb

Hey support folks! When a customer says their video thumbnails look stuck, it's usually the ThumbForge queue backing up. You can peek at queue depth yourself via the status dashboard — no need to page engineering unless it's over 10k. To log in to the dashboard, use the key below.

service key, yadug-bajog: zpat3_pou

Heads up for whoever's on call this week: the cron drift thing with Quillhost is still open on their side. Their scheduler nodes drifted about 40 seconds last Tuesday, which is why the Larkspur export fired twice. They claim an NTP fix shipped Friday, but I'd keep an eye on the 03:15 jobs through the weekend. Ticket history is in the vendor tracker under Quillhost. If it recurs, contact their support queue directly.

pager mailbox: druwyn@norvaio.corp

Runbook: SweepWarden account recovery. If the sweeper's service account is disabled after a failed credential rotation, orphaned-resource scans will halt and the release pipeline will block on stale artifacts. The release manager should initiate recovery from the admin panel, confirm the last successful sweep timestamp, and re-enable the account. The recovery step prompts for the standing passphrase, which is:

vault phrase of tajef-tafog = istox-sorax-zorox-casok-holox-kelix-weneth-drueth-casion

## Onboarding — Markdown Pipeline (Inkmere)

Inkmere docs render through a three-stage pipeline: parse, sanitize, emit. Releases rebuild all templates; never hot-patch emitted HTML. Broken renders usually mean a sanitizer rule change — check the rules diff first. The render cluster only accepts builds from the release channel, and every build artifact must be signed before upload. Sign artifacts with the deploy key below.

release key, hafop-tajef: bky13_s2vaFVNJTHfBL